Katherine Warington School is seeking a committed Learning Support Assistant for term time only plus 5 days, including INSET days. The role supports students, teachers and the school to raise achievement and promote inclusion, with a focus on SEND, EAL and those needing extra help.
The successful candidate will have excellent numeracy and literacy, strong organisational skills and a patient, flexible approach. DBS clearance is required in the selection process.
